Small, quaint Thai restaurant. Because the restaurant is small, they have limited seating. I was able to get a table quickly because it was after the dinner rush hour. Service was quick, and friendly. They have a good selection of traditional Thai dishes. Prices are high, probably because of location. I ordered Penang Curry with chicken. I requested additional vegetables, and was accommodated with a small up charge. The price for the dish was 20,00 and with the upcharge came to 23.00 It was served on a plate as opposed to a bowl, which I'm used to at most Thai restaurants. It was nicely presented, and came with jasmine rice, however, I could tell right away, it didn't have enough curry sauce for my liking. I ended up asking for more sauce because there just wasn't enough. It was also on the thin side. One way they can improve the dish is by serving it in a nice size bowl, and giving more sauce. I also think the the sauce could be a tad thicker. Making these adjustments would make the dish much better. Their sauce is very good, though the dish needs double or more of the curry sauce than it currently comes with. I also ordered desert, an inexpensive pudding. 3.00 and it was delicious. With tax and tip, my bill was just over 34.00 Street or lot parking can be difficult during busy times.
